Microsoft Corporation Senior Technical Program Manager in Redmond, Washington

Do you want to help shape the future of Microsoft’s relationship and partnership with the biggest names in cloud-based game streaming providers while delighting gamers everywhere by unlocking gaming experiences that they might otherwise be unable to participate in?

Microsoft’s Xbox organization seeks to empower every game creator to realize their dreams of connecting with gamers everywhere. Our product team seeks to do that at scale by building and leveraging our partnerships with the biggest names in game streaming.

To deliver on this goal, you as Senior Technical Program Manager will focus on integrating and improving our Xbox platforms on partner streaming services. You’ll coordinate with external streaming providers and internal Microsoft stakeholders to ensure our platforms and services work seamlessly on streaming platforms. You will also deliver and report on compliance requirements and needs in the game streaming space, working closely with our legal counsel and internal game studios.

Responsibilities

Platform Health & Compliance : Drive platform integration and improvements in partnership with external game streaming companies. Track, report and deliver compliance and contractual requirements in the product space.

Cross-Functional Collaboration : Collaborate effectively with internal and external development partners, including designers, engineers, artists, and external studios. Manage relationships and ensure the smooth execution of projects.

Execution Excellence : Oversee project planning and execution, ensuring milestones are met, risks are identified and mitigated, and deliverables are of the highest quality. Continuously monitor and improve processes to optimize project outcomes. Attention to detail and ability to balance multiple workstreams at once.

Inclusive Leadership : Foster a diverse and inclusive work environment that values the contributions of all team members. Promote an atmosphere where different perspectives are respected and considered in decision-making.

Executive Communication : Demonstrate executive communication skills, including the ability to present ideas clearly and concisely to senior leadership and stakeholders. Provide regular updates on project status and key insights.

Industry Expertise : Bring an understanding of the games industry and the long-term evolution of the Game Streaming space. Use this knowledge to inform product strategy and decision-making.

Qualifications

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ree AND 4+ years experience in engineering, product/technical program management, data analysis, or product development

  • OR equivalent experience.

  • 2+ years experience managing cross-functional and/or cross-team projects.

  • 4+ years experience in technology product and program management driving technical engineering teams to solutions.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ree AND 8+ years experience in engineering, product/technical program management, data analysis, or product development

  • OR equivalent experience.

  • 4+ years of experience in organizational, written and verbal skills.

  • 6+ years experience managing cross-functional and/or cross-team projects.

  • Knowledge of the gaming industry with a specific focus on cloud-based game streaming and associated technologies.

  • Experience working with external companies, in partnership to achieve business goals and objectives.

Technical Program Management IC4 - The typical base pay range for this role across the U.S. is USD $112,000 - $218,400 per year. There is a different range applicable to specific work locations, within the San Francisco Bay area and New York City metropolitan area, and the base pay range for this role in those locations is USD $145,800 - $238,600 per year.
